OK, so like I think I have a major leak in my exaust.... I think its been there since day 1... Like you go under my car and put your hand near where the exaust bolts to the downpipe/cat and like you can feel SHYTE loads of air coming out there. Also when you punch it you have a whoosh sound hehe, and like when you first start your car up theres like a clicking noise? So like, I guess thats a problem?

I will be getting this fixed on friday.

2 questions though.

1.) would that cause a loss in power?

2.) would that cause slight knock?
(cause like sometimes I see 1-2 degrees of kock when I near 7000RPM.)
